The Basics of Your Ceiling Fan Reverse Switch Wiring Diagram

A Ceiling Fan Reverse Switch Wiring Diagram is essentially a visual guide that illustrates the electrical connections within your ceiling fan, specifically focusing on how the reverse switch operates. This switch allows you to change the direction of the fan blades. In the summer, you typically want the fan to push air downwards, creating a cooling breeze. In the winter, you might want the fan to rotate in the opposite direction, drawing cooler air up and pushing warmer air that has risen to the ceiling downwards along the walls, which helps circulate heat without creating a draft.

The diagram shows the various wires and their corresponding terminals. Key components you'll often see include:

  • Line (Hot) Wire: This is the incoming power from your home's electrical system.
  • Neutral Wire: This wire completes the electrical circuit.
  • Ground Wire: For safety, this wire provides a path for electricity in case of a fault.
  • Fan Motor Wires: These wires connect to the fan's motor.
  • Capacitor Wires: Capacitors help start and run the motor.
  • Reverse Switch Terminals: These are the connection points on the reverse switch itself.

The proper understanding and application of this diagram are paramount for safe and effective fan operation. Incorrect wiring can lead to the fan not working, malfunctioning, or even posing an electrical hazard.

Here's a simplified representation of what a typical diagram might illustrate:

Component Connection Example
Line Wire Connects to one side of the reverse switch and the fan motor.
Neutral Wire Connects directly to the fan motor.
Reverse Switch Output Depending on the switch position, this connects to different windings within the fan motor to change direction.
Ground Wire Connects to the fan's metal housing and the house ground.

By tracing the paths on the Ceiling Fan Reverse Switch Wiring Diagram, you can identify which wire goes where and how the switch alters the flow of electricity to achieve the desired rotation. This is especially helpful when:

  1. Installing a new ceiling fan.
  2. Replacing a faulty reverse switch.
  3. Troubleshooting why your fan isn't reversing.
  4. Identifying the wires for a universal remote installation.
